TinySDF is a tiny and fast JavaScript library for generating SDF (signed distance field)
|
||||
from system fonts on the browser using Canvas 2D and
|
||||
[Felzenszwalb/Huttenlocher distance transform](https://cs.brown.edu/~pff/papers/dt-final.pdf).
|
||||
This is very useful for [rendering text with WebGL](https://www.mapbox.com/blog/text-signed-distance-fields/).
|
||||
|
||||
## [Demo](http://mapbox.github.io/tiny-sdf)
|
||||
|
||||
## Usage
|
||||
|
||||
Create a TinySDF for drawing glyph SDFs based on font parameters:
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
const tinySdf = new TinySDF({
|
||||
fontSize: 24, // Font size in pixels
|
||||
fontFamily: 'sans-serif', // CSS font-family
|
||||
fontWeight: 'normal', // CSS font-weight
|
||||
fontStyle: 'normal', // CSS font-style
|
||||
buffer: 3, // Whitespace buffer around a glyph in pixels
|
||||
radius: 8, // How many pixels around the glyph shape to use for encoding distance
|
||||
cutoff: 0.25 // How much of the radius (relative) is used for the inside part of the glyph
|
||||
});
|
||||
|
||||
const glyph = tinySdf.draw('泽'); // draw a single character
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Returns an object with the following properties:
|
||||
|
||||
- `data` is a `Uint8ClampedArray` array of alpha values (0–255) for a `width` x `height` grid.
|
||||
- `width`: Width of the returned bitmap.
|
||||
- `height`: Height of the returned bitmap.
|
||||
- `glyphTop`: Maximum ascent of the glyph from alphabetic baseline.
|
||||
- `glyphLeft`: Currently hardwired to 0 (actual glyph differences are encoded in the rasterization).
|
||||
- `glyphWidth`: Width of the rasterized portion of the glyph.
|
||||
- `glyphHeight` Height of the rasterized portion of the glyph.
|
||||
- `glyphAdvance`: Layout advance.
|
||||
|
||||
TinySDF is provided as a ES module, so it's only supported on modern browsers, excluding IE.

# vector-tile
|
||||
|
||||
This library reads [Mapbox Vector Tiles](https://github.com/mapbox/vector-tile-spec) and allows access to the layers and features.
|
||||
|
||||
## Example
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
import {VectorTile} from '@mapbox/vector-tile';
|
||||
import Protobuf from 'pbf';
|
||||
|
||||
const tile = new VectorTile(new Protobuf(data));
|
||||
|
||||
// Contains a map of all layers
|
||||
tile.layers;
|
||||
|
||||
const landuse = tile.layers.landuse;
|
||||
|
||||
// Amount of features in this layer
|
||||
landuse.length;
|
||||
|
||||
// Returns the first feature
|
||||
landuse.feature(0);
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Vector tiles contained in [serialtiles-spec](https://github.com/mapbox/serialtiles-spec)
|
||||
are gzip-encoded, so a complete example of parsing them with the native
|
||||
zlib module would be:
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
import {VectorTile} from '@mapbox/vector-tile';
|
||||
import Protobuf from 'pbf';
|
||||
import {gunzipSync} from 'zlib';
|
||||
|
||||
const buffer = gunzipSync(data);
|
||||
const tile = new VectorTile(new Protobuf(buffer));
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Install
|
||||
|
||||
To install:
|
||||
|
||||
npm install @mapbox/vector-tile
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
## API Reference
|
||||
|
||||
### VectorTile
|
||||
|
||||
An object that parses vector tile data and makes it readable.
|
||||
|
||||
#### Constructor
|
||||
|
||||
- **new VectorTile(protobuf[, end])** —
|
||||
parses the vector tile data contained in the given [Protobuf](https://github.com/mapbox/pbf) object,
|
||||
saving resulting layers in the created object as a `layers` property. Optionally accepts end index.
|
||||
|
||||
#### Properties
|
||||
|
||||
- **layers** (Object) — an object containing parsed layers in the form of `{<name>: <layer>, ...}`,
|
||||
where each layer is a `VectorTileLayer` object.
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
### VectorTileLayer
|
||||
|
||||
An object that contains the data for a single vector tile layer.
|
||||
|
||||
#### Properties
|
||||
|
||||
- **version** (`Number`, default: `1`)
|
||||
- **name** (`String`) — layer name
|
||||
- **extent** (`Number`, default: `4096`) — tile extent size
|
||||
- **length** (`Number`) — number of features in the layer
|
||||
|
||||
#### Methods
|
||||
|
||||
- **feature(i)** — get a feature (`VectorTileFeature`) by the given index from the layer.
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
### VectorTileFeature
|
||||
|
||||
An object that contains the data for a single feature.
|
||||
|
||||
#### Properties
|
||||
|
||||
- **type** (`Number`) — type of the feature (also see `VectorTileFeature.types`)
|
||||
- **extent** (`Number`) — feature extent size
|
||||
- **id** (`Number`) — feature identifier, if present
|
||||
- **properties** (`Object`) — object literal with feature properties
|
||||
|
||||
#### Methods
|
||||
|
||||
- **loadGeometry()** — parses feature geometry and returns an array of
|
||||
[Point](https://github.com/mapbox/point-geometry) arrays (with each point having `x` and `y` properties)
|
||||
- **bbox()** — calculates and returns the bounding box of the feature in the form `[x1, y1, x2, y2]`
|
||||
- **toGeoJSON(x, y, z)** — returns a GeoJSON representation of the feature. (`x`, `y`, and `z` refer to the containing tile's index.)
